Local Weather Risks in Huxford
Triggers
Heavy rainfall, tropical storms, hurricane remnants, and flash flooding events are the most common weather triggers for mold emergencies in Escambia County. Sustained humidity above 60% indoors can also initiate mold growth even without a visible leak.
Seasonal Risks
Mold emergencies in the Huxford area peak during the hot, humid months from May through October. High humidity combined with afternoon thunderstorms creates ideal conditions for mold to bloom. Winter cold snaps can also trigger emergencies when pipes freeze and burst, releasing water into wall cavities and under floors.
Disaster Scenarios
Post-storm flooding is the most serious mold trigger in the Huxford area. After a hurricane or severe thunderstorm, standing water can saturate homes for days. Floodborne contaminants accelerate toxic mold growth. Homes in low-lying areas and near drainage paths face the highest risk. Freeze-thaw cycles in winter can also cause hidden pipe bursts that go unnoticed until mold is visible.

Emergency Prevention Tips
- ✓ Fix leaks immediately — a slow drip behind a wall can create a mold hotspot in under 48 hours
- ✓ Keep indoor humidity below 50% using dehumidifiers, especially during Huxford's humid summer months
- ✓ Inspect attics, crawlspaces, and basements after every heavy rain or storm for signs of water intrusion
- ✓ Clean and dry any wet carpets, furniture, or drywall within 24 hours to prevent mold colonization
- ✓ Ensure gutters and downspouts direct water at least 5 feet away from your home's foundation
- ✓ Install moisture alarms near water heaters, washing machines, and under sinks for early leak detection
- ✓ Maintain your HVAC system — clogged condensate drains are a common hidden source of mold-feeding moisture
